Output 04c89b909158a5c5a0f92aeb541a0a2d774553c0aa34b1fb2646e6140f9cc161:0

value
737467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a3ac855ca22406bc0e66085b961362024c75fa OP_EQUAL
address
3DRCVMsaXKZQf4kHiDDzR1Ya6Mph178Ezw
transaction
04c89b909158a5c5a0f92aeb541a0a2d774553c0aa34b1fb2646e6140f9cc161
confirmations
83844
spent
true